Pre-race routine:

The usual. Got up about 2 hours early (only 20-25 min drive to the race site). Usual light breakfast, headed to the race.
Event warmup:

Jogged around for a few minutes, and stepped into the lake and splashed a bit, tried to get used to sighting, since I've never done it before.
Swim
  • 06m 34s
  • 408 meters
  • 01m 37s / 100 meters
Comments:

Very intersting for my first OWS race. Started in the 2nd wave, at the front. From the start, stayed side by side with 2 other people, but we broke away from the wave immediately. Sighting the first bouy was a nightmare, as we were staring straight into the sun. I basically just hoped the person next to me saw it well, because I was having trouble. Made it around the bouy (150m or so out) pretty easy, which is when I broke away. the next 200m or so was a straight shot, keeping bouys on your right. Had to weave through the BOP from the first wave, which was intersting. Also started to tire a little bit more than I wanted, felt like the stroke broke down. First out of the water, so I can't complain.
What would you do differently?:

Practice sighting a little bit more...
Transition 1
  • 01m 26s
Comments:

Put shoes on at T1, as opposed to leave them on bike. Sockless for first time, didn't pose a problem. Towel at T1 was helpful in getting gravel off my feet. Definitely slower than the FOPers, but not slow compared to the whole field.
What would you do differently?:

Need to work on more of a smooth mount on the bike. Other than that, getting everything on (helmet, sunglassees, race belt) was pretty smooth.
Bike
  • 29m 37s
  • 11 miles
  • 22.28 mile/hr
Comments:

Solid ride, at least for me. Didn't have my HR monitor on, so I don't know where I was at in that respect. I still don't like doing U-turns, but everything else I thought was solid. Was out by myself for the most part, as I had passed a lot of people in the water. Took a few sips from the bottle just to wet my mouth/throat. For me, a good average. But still my weakest link against the field. Can't wait for my new bike and race wheels...
Transition 2
  • 00m 43s
Comments:

Not too much trouble getting feet out of and on top of shoes. Still not the smoothest thing for me, but getting the hang of it. Being in a big gear is crucial to run with the bike with shoes on (learned that at Cleburne, one shoe got dragged and ripped off).
Run
  • 13m 48s
  • 2 miles
  • 06m 54s  min/mile
Comments:

Rough run. Calves cramping up immediately off the bike, took some slowing down and 1/2 mile to keep them in check. Had a hard time controlling my breathing and pushing through the pain. Not nearly as fast as I would have liked...wish I knew why I was cramping. May have been hydration and humidity?
What would you do differently?:

More bricks?
Post race
Warm down:

10 minute jog.

What limited your ability to perform faster:

Training schedule has been more sporadic than I would like. Should be better soon...

Event comments:

Good first OWS race.
